在快速发展的企业计算领域中,部署在美国数据中心的AMD独立服务器已成为追求最佳性能和成本效益的企业的重要改革力量。本文深入探讨为什么AMD的服务器解决方案,特别是EPYC系列,正在成为现代企业基础设施的支柱。

深入理解AMD EPYC的技术优势

AMD EPYC处理器代表着服务器架构的范式转变。最新的第四代EPYC处理器每个CPU最多可支持96个核心,这些强大的处理器提供了前所未有的并行处理能力。让我们来看一个实际的性能比较:


# 性能基准测试比较(Python脚本)
import numpy as np

def benchmark_matrix_multiplication(size):
    # 创建随机矩阵
    A = np.random.rand(size, size)
    B = np.random.rand(size, size)
    
    # 执行乘法运算
    return np.matmul(A, B)

# AMD EPYC与竞品的性能指标
# 矩阵大小:10000 x 10000
# AMD EPYC 9654:约0.8秒
# 竞品:约1.2秒

这个基准测试展示了AMD EPYC卓越的并行处理能力,这对数据密集型操作尤为重要。该架构的多线程效率直接转化为企业应用程序更快的实际性能。

美国数据中心基础设施的战略优势

在美国数据中心部署AMD服务器提供的战略优势不仅限于纯计算能力。其强大的基础设施包括:

  • T4级数据中心冗余
  • 多运营商中立连接选项
  • 先进的电力分配系统
  • 最先进的制冷解决方案

通过硬件-软件集成实现性能优化

现代企业工作负载需要优化的硬件-软件集成。以下是AMD服务器在实际场景中的出色表现:


// Node.js服务器性能配置示例
const cluster = require('cluster');
const numCPUs = require('os').cpus().length;

if (cluster.isMaster) {
    console.log(`主进程 ${process.pid} 正在运行`);
    
    // 基于AMD EPYC核心数量创建工作进程
    for (let i = 0; i < numCPUs; i++) {
        cluster.fork();
    }
    
    cluster.on('exit', (worker, code, signal) => {
        console.log(`工作进程 ${worker.process.pid} 已终止`);
    });
} else {
    // 工作进程可以共享任何TCP连接
    require('./server');
}

// 性能指标:
// 请求处理能力:提升40%
// 响应时间:延迟降低35%

成本效益分析

在评估总体拥有成本(TCO)时,美国数据中心的AMD独立服务器展现出显著优势:

指标AMD EPYC解决方案传统设置
能源效率每核心0.8千瓦时每核心1.2千瓦时
性价比提升1.4倍基准值
散热需求降低25%基准值

安全架构与合规性

AMD的安全功能通过硬件级实现提供企业级保护:


# 安全实现示例
class SecureVirtualization:
    def __init__(self):
        self.sev_enabled = True
        self.memory_encryption = "AES-128"
        self.secure_boot = True
    
    def verify_attestation(self):
        return {
            "platform": "AMD EPYC",
            "security_features": {
                "SEV": True,
                "SME": True,
                "SNP": True
            }
        }

此实现展示了AMD的安全加密虚拟化(SEV),为每个虚拟机提供硬件级内存加密,这对多租户环境至关重要。

工作负载特定优化技术

不同的业务场景需要特定的优化方法。以下是AMD服务器在各种用例中的卓越表现:

高性能计算(HPC)

AMD EPYC处理器利用其高核心数量和内存带宽进行复杂的科学计算。性能特点如下:

  • 内存带宽:每个插槽高达512 GB/s
  • PCIe通道:每个处理器128条通道
  • 缓存结构:高达384MB的三级缓存

数据库操作

对于数据库密集型应用,该架构提供显著优势:


-- PostgreSQL针对AMD EPYC的优化示例
ALTER SYSTEM SET max_parallel_workers_per_gather = 8;
ALTER SYSTEM SET max_parallel_workers = 96;
ALTER SYSTEM SET shared_buffers = '256GB';
ALTER SYSTEM SET effective_cache_size = '768GB';
ALTER SYSTEM SET maintenance_work_mem = '4GB';

-- 优化结果:
-- 复杂查询速度提升40%
-- 并行扫描性能提升65%
-- 整体吞吐量提升30%

网络架构和全球连通性

美国数据中心基础设施为AMD服务器部署提供卓越的网络功能:

  • 多个100 Gbps主干连接
  • 与主要CDN直接对等互联
  • 网络层面的DDoS防护
  • 地理负载均衡能力

部署最佳实践

为最大化您的AMD服务器投资,请考虑以下部署策略:


# 部署配置模板
apiVersion: v1
kind: Deployment
metadata:
  name: high-performance-workload
spec:
  replicas: 3
  selector:
    matchLabels:
      app: enterprise-workload
  template:
    spec:
      nodeSelector:
        cpu: amd-epyc
      containers:
      - name: main-application
        resources:
          requests:
            cpu: "8"
            memory: "32Gi"
          limits:
            cpu: "16"
            memory: "64Gi"

性能监控与优化

实施全面监控以维持最佳性能:


#!/bin/bash
# AMD EPYC服务器性能监控脚本

# CPU温度和频率监控
watch -n 1 "cat /sys/class/thermal/thermal_zone*/temp && cat /proc/cpuinfo | grep 'MHz'"

# 内存使用率追踪
while true; do
    free -m
    sleep 5
done

# I/O性能监控
iostat -x 1

面向未来的基础设施

AMD的产品路线图和美国数据中心的发展确保长期可扩展性:

  • 即将推出的CPU架构改进
  • 增强的内存密度支持
  • 先进的电源管理功能
  • 扩展的虚拟化功能

结论和实施策略

美国数据中心的AMD独立服务器代表着对企业技术基础的战略投资。EPYC处理器的原始性能、先进的安全功能和最佳托管环境的结合,创造了一个能够处理下一代工作负载的基础设施。

对于考虑AMD服务器租用解决方案的企业,建议从全面的工作负载分析开始,逐步迁移关键应用。基于证据的性能提升和成本效益使美国AMD独立服务器成为现代企业架构的重要组成部分。